117.info
人生若只如初见

怎么清除java高速缓存

要清除Java高速缓存,可以采取以下方法:

  1. 重启应用程序:在Java应用程序中,高速缓存通常是在内存中存储的,因此可以通过重启应用程序来清除缓存。这将导致缓存被清除并重新加载。

  2. 使用缓存管理工具:一些Java框架和库提供了缓存管理工具,可以使用这些工具来清除缓存。例如,Spring框架提供的CacheManager接口可以用于管理和清除缓存。

  3. 使用缓存注解:如果你的应用程序使用了缓存注解,可以尝试使用注解提供的清除缓存的功能。例如,Spring框架的@CacheEvict注解可以用于清除指定的缓存。

  4. 手动清除缓存:如果你的应用程序没有使用缓存管理工具或缓存注解,你可以手动清除缓存。这可以通过访问缓存对象并调用清除方法来实现。具体的实现方式取决于你使用的缓存库或框架。

需要注意的是,清除缓存可能会导致性能下降,因为下次访问相同的数据时需要重新加载缓存。因此,在清除缓存之前,需要评估清除缓存对应用程序性能的影响,并谨慎决定是否清除缓存。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e776AzsLAw5fBVU.html

推荐文章

  • java多线程中怎么给对象加锁

    在Java中,可以使用关键字synchronized来给对象加锁。具体的方法有两种: 使用synchronized方法:在方法声明中使用synchronized关键字,表示该方法一次只能被一个...

  • java优先队列的用法是什么

    Java中的优先队列(PriorityQueue)是一种特殊的队列,其中的元素按照优先级进行排序。具体来说,优先队列中的元素可以使用自然顺序或自定义的比较器进行排序。<...

  • java多线程加锁的方法是什么

    Java中多线程加锁的方法有以下几种: synchronized关键字:通过在方法前面或代码块前面加上synchronized关键字来实现加锁。synchronized关键字可以修饰方法和代码...

  • java登录验证码怎么做

    要实现一个Java的登录验证码功能,可以按照以下步骤进行操作: 创建一个随机生成验证码的方法,可以使用Java的随机数生成器来生成随机的验证码。例如,可以使用R...

  • java怎么解析tcp报文

    在Java中,可以使用Socket类来解析TCP报文。以下是一个简单的示例:
    import java.io.DataInputStream;
    import java.io.IOException;
    import java...

  • 怎么用python输出三角形面积和周长

    要计算三角形的面积和周长,需要知道三角形的三条边长。
    以下是用Python计算三角形面积和周长的示例代码:
    import math def calculate_area(a, b, c):...

  • java怎么清除cookie数据

    要清除cookie数据,可以使用以下代码:
    Cookie[] cookies = request.getCookies();
    if (cookies != null) { for (Cookie cookie : cookies) { cookie....

  • win10共享文件夹怎么设置

    要设置Win10共享文件夹,您可以按照以下步骤操作: 打开“文件资源管理器”,然后导航到要共享的文件夹。
    右键单击该文件夹,并选择“属性”。
    在属性...